Maximizing BMI Resin Performance with Diallyl Bisphenol A (DBA)
Bismaleimide (BMI) resins are renowned for their exceptional thermal stability and mechanical properties, making them a preferred choice for high-performance applications across industries like aerospace, electronics, and automotive. However, their inherent cost and sometimes challenging processing can be limiting factors. This is where Diallyl Bisphenol A (DBA), CAS No. 1745-89-7, steps in as a crucial modifier. DBA, characterized by its yellow sticky liquid appearance and a purity typically above 96%, acts as a powerful modifier. Its primary function is to significantly reduce the application cost of BMI resins. This cost-efficiency, combined with improved handling and processability, makes DBA an attractive additive for manufacturers looking to enhance their product lifecycle and market competitiveness. The benefits of incorporating DBA into BMI formulations extend beyond cost savings. DBA is known to substantially improve the toughness and heat resistance of BMI resins. This enhanced thermal stability is critical for components operating in high-temperature environments, such as electrical insulation materials, copper-clad circuit boards, and aerospace structural components. By improving these key properties, DBA enables the creation of more robust and durable end products.
Furthermore, DBA finds application as an effective anti-aging agent for rubber. When added to rubber formulations at concentrations of 1-3%, DBA can significantly improve the rubber's resistance to aging processes. This means longer-lasting rubber products, reducing replacement frequency and improving overall product reliability.
